Here’s how I turned my Lovable website into a real app that’s getting published on the Play Store soon Just follow these steps: Step 1 – Build your website on Lovable Step 2 – To make it Play Store–ready, you’ll need a manifest.js file in your code with all the app details (name, description, icons, colors, etc.). Paste this prompt into Lovable: “Generate a complete manifest.js file to convert my website into a Progressive Web App (PWA) ready for publishing on the Google Play Store. Include app name, short name, description, start URL, display mode (standalone), theme and background colors, icons (192x192 and 512x512).” Step 3 – Go to median.co, paste your Lovable site link. It’ll generate a PWA. Test it on mobile, then hit Build → Play Store. If your manifest is set up right, it’ll generate a ZIP with your .aab, .apk, and key. Step 4 – Head to the Google Play Console, start a new app, and upload the .aab and key file the entire process in my article below
